Carlos Sainz: "Every time I feel better"

Carlos Sainz finished the official qualifying session of the Formula 1 Portuguese Grand Prix in an honorable fifth position. The Madrid driver classified his position on the grid as good, assuring that he had faced "difficult conditions", especially due to the gusty wind on the track. Likewise, the Madrid rider acknowledged that he was able to improve the sensations compared to other events: “It was a tough qualifying, as always here in Portimao, with very gusty wind. The track slowed down again in Q3, similar to last year. Even so, we have been able to go through sessions, improving feelings during the weekend and we have been able to do a good fifth in qualifying, "he told DAZN. In addition, the Madrid driver explained his decision to save tire in Q1 and to pass later with the soft one. “We were very close to risking passing with the medium, but because of the traffic at the beginning of Q2 I was not able to do a good first lap with the medium. In order not to risk and go to Q3, we have decided to put the soft. It is the right decision, there was no risk, especially in the first races. That has allowed me to get a good feeling with the soft and do a couple of good laps in Q3, "he said." When I finished the lap and saw that I was three tenths away from Q2, I thought I was going to be the tenth. Then it was seen that the others suffered as well, I was not the only one. Here, making perfect laps does not exist, because there is always a curve in which you get a gust of wind and annoy you. Even so, we have been able to improve the sensations, change the driving style… That has allowed me today, in difficult conditions, to get a good fifth, ”he concluded.
